Most of the chants explained:
We sang « simplement deux/un » for every 2/1 count because our French commentators made it a gimmick since they started covering WWE for 22+ years so it’s an hommage.
There were also « c’est pas gentil/ c’était méchant » which means « that’s not nice/ that was mean » it’s stupid but also funny, like the most pg chant ever.
For Street Profits « Allez les bleus! » that’s a chant we use for our national teams in Football/Rugby/Handball/Basketball and since they were wearing blue we used it for them.
And finally for AJ we were singing « Il est vraiment Phenomenal » which could translate to « he really is phenomenal », which the two of them played with it because they heard us singing that earlier during the pre show. Honestly it was one of the most funny chants of the night, especially when Cody intentionally said Phenomenal to make us sing it again, but it seems a lot of people didn’t understood and thought we were disrespectful when we were just paying hommage to AJ.
